Is there a way to format a decimal as following:

100   -> "100"  
100.1 -> "100.10"

If it is a round number, omit the decimal part. Otherwise format with two decimal places.

I'd recommend using the java.text package:

double money = 100.1;
NumberFormat formatter = NumberFormat.getCurrencyInstance();
String moneyString = formatter.format(money);
System.out.println(moneyString);

This has the added benefit of being locale specific.

But, if you must, truncate the String you get back if it's a whole dollar:

if (moneyString.endsWith(".00")) {
    int centsIndex = moneyString.lastIndexOf(".00");
    if (centsIndex != -1) {
        moneyString = moneyString.substring(1, centsIndex);
    }
}

I doubt it. The problem is that 100 is never 100 if it's a float, it's normally 99.9999999999 or 100.0000001 or something like that.

If you do want to format it that way, you have to define an epsilon, that is, a maximum distance from an integer number, and use integer formatting if the difference is smaller, and a float otherwise.

Something like this would do the trick:

public String formatDecimal(float number) {
  float epsilon = 0.004f; // 4 tenths of a cent
  if (Math.abs(Math.round(number) - number) < epsilon) {
     return String.format("%10.0f", number); // sdb
  } else {
     return String.format("%10.2f", number); // dj_segfault
  }
}

I think this is simple and clear for printing a currency:

DecimalFormat df = new DecimalFormat("$###,###.##"); // or pattern "###,###.##$"
System.out.println(df.format(12345.678));

output: $12,345.68

And one of possible solutions for the question:

public static void twoDecimalsOrOmit(double d) {
    System.out.println(new DecimalFormat(d%1 == 0 ? "###.##" : "###.00").format(d));
}

twoDecimalsOrOmit((double) 100);
twoDecimalsOrOmit(100.1);

Output:

100

100.10

I agree with @duffymo that you need to use the java.text.NumberFormat methods for this sort of things. You can actually do all the formatting natively in it without doing any String compares yourself:

private String formatPrice(final double priceAsDouble) 
{
    NumberFormat formatter = NumberFormat.getCurrencyInstance();
    if (Math.round(priceAsDouble * 100) % 100 == 0) {
        formatter.setMaximumFractionDigits(0);
    }
    return formatter.format(priceAsDouble);
}

Couple bits to point out:

  • The whole Math.round(priceAsDouble * 100) % 100 is just working around the inaccuracies of doubles/floats. Basically just checking if we round to the hundreds place (maybe this is a U.S. bias) are there remaining cents.
  • The trick to remove the decimals is the setMaximumFractionDigits() method

Whatever your logic for determining whether or not the decimals should get truncated, setMaximumFractionDigits() should get used.

This is what I did, using an integer to represent the amount as cents instead:

public static String format(int moneyInCents) {
    String format;
    Number value;
    if (moneyInCents % 100 == 0) {
        format = "%d";
        value = moneyInCents / 100;
    } else {
        format = "%.2f";
        value = moneyInCents / 100.0;
    }
    return String.format(Locale.US, format, value);
}

The problem with NumberFormat.getCurrencyInstance() is that sometimes you really want $20 to be $20, it just looks better than $20.00.

If anyone finds a better way of doing this, using NumberFormat, I'm all ears.
